// Creates a new image pipeline. Image pipelines enable you to automate the
// creation and distribution of images.
func (c *Client) CreateImagePipeline(ctx context.Context, params *CreateImagePipelineInput, optFns ...func(*Options)) (*CreateImagePipelineOutput, error) {
if params == nil {
params = &CreateImagePipelineInput{}
}
result, metadata, err := c.invokeOperation(ctx, "CreateImagePipeline", params, optFns, c.addOperationCreateImagePipelineMiddlewares)
if err != nil {
return nil, err
}
out := result.(*CreateImagePipelineOutput)
out.ResultMetadata = metadata
return out, nil
}
type CreateImagePipelineInput struct {
// The idempotency token used to make this request idempotent.
//
// This member is required.
ClientToken *string
// The Amazon Resource Name (ARN) of the infrastructure configuration that will be
// used to build images created by this image pipeline.
//
// This member is required.
InfrastructureConfigurationArn *string
// The name of the image pipeline.
//
// This member is required.
Name *string
// The Amazon Resource Name (ARN) of the container recipe that is used to configure
// images created by this container pipeline.
ContainerRecipeArn *string
// The description of the image pipeline.
Description *string
// The Amazon Resource Name (ARN) of the distribution configuration that will be
// used to configure and distribute images created by this image pipeline.
DistributionConfigurationArn *string
// Collects additional information about the image being created, including the
// operating system (OS) version and package list. This information is used to
// enhance the overall experience of using EC2 Image Builder. Enabled by default.
EnhancedImageMetadataEnabled *bool
// The Amazon Resource Name (ARN) of the image recipe that will be used to
// configure images created by this image pipeline.
ImageRecipeArn *string
// The image test configuration of the image pipeline.
ImageTestsConfiguration *types.ImageTestsConfiguration
// The schedule of the image pipeline.
Schedule *types.Schedule
// The status of the image pipeline.
Status types.PipelineStatus
// The tags of the image pipeline.
Tags map[string]string
noSmithyDocumentSerde
}
type CreateImagePipelineOutput struct {
// The idempotency token used to make this request idempotent.
ClientToken *string
// The Amazon Resource Name (ARN) of the image pipeline that was created by this
// request.
ImagePipelineArn *string
// The request ID that uniquely identifies this request.
RequestId *string
// Metadata pertaining to the operation's result.
ResultMetadata middleware.Metadata
noSmithyDocumentSerde
}
